Abstract

Indonesia is currently experiencing rapid development in the creative economy sector. Various industries such as design, fashion, art, music, film, and others have become the backbone of creative economic growth in this country. One of the most valuable assets in the creative economy is a brand. Brand protection is very important to ensure the continued growth of Indonesia's creative economy. This research aims to determine and analyze the importance of trademark registration in the development of small and medium enterprises in the creative economy of Indonesia and trademark protection in the development of small and medium enterprises in the creative economy. The research results show the importance of registering a trademark, including: To obtain legal protection, exclusive rights to use the trademark, as a publicity tool (promotion), and also as a business opportunity. Brand protection in the development of micro, small, and medium enterprises in the creative economy sector in Indonesia can be done in two ways, namely preventive protection and repressive protection.
